Pharmacological treatment in autism: a proposal for guidelines on common co-occurring psychiatric symptoms
Abstract Background The prevalence of autism spectrum disorder (ASD) has surged, with an estimated 1 in 36 eight-year-olds in the United States meeting criteria for ASD in 2020.
